Continue até o Teatro Antigo de Epidauro, um teatro do século IV que é uma das estruturas gregas clássicas mais bem preservadas existentes. É conhecido por sua incrível acústica; uma moeda jogada no centro do teatro pode ser ouvida do assento mais alto. O teatro acomoda até 14.000 pessoas e sua entrada é ladeada por pilastras coríntias restauradas. Por último, mas não menos importante, faça uma parada na pitoresca cidade de Nafplion, que foi a primeira capital da Grécia após a Independência e tem sido um importante porto desde a Idade do Bronze. Sua posição era tão estratégica que a cidade tem 3 fortalezas: a enorme fortaleza de Palamidi, a menor Akronafplia e o castelo aquático Bourtzi em uma ilhota a oeste da cidade velha. Passeie pelas atraentes ruas estreitas e admire as elegantes casas venezianas, mansões neoclássicas e cafés no cais.
